Our Game of Thrones tour starts next to Tourist Info Center. Our official guide (with a superhero hat) will meet you and after group assembles, you will go for a 2 hour adventure visiting places from the Game of Thrones show.

2

We start down by the water at Kolorina, where you’ll instantly recognize Blackwater Bay. This tiny beach was the backdrop for so many key moments — from King Joffrey and Cersei sending off Princess Myrcella, to Tyrion plotting strategy with Varys before the epic Battle of Blackwater. Standing here, you’ll feel like you’re right in the middle of King’s Landing’s drama.

3

Fans will remember this place as the pier where Sansa confides in Shae, before Littlefinger shows up with one of his schemes. This is also where the wildfire scenes were shot, giving you a glimpse into the fiery special effects magic.

From here you have amazing views of fort Lovrijenac, which doubled as the Red Keep. This was the stage for some of the most unforgettable scenes: Joffrey’s name-day tourney, the infamous Purple Wedding, and endless power struggles inside the Great Hall

4
Stop 4

We head to Pile Gate, the main entrance to Dubrovnik’s Old Town. In the show, it became the chaotic streets of King’s Landing when Joffrey lost his temper with starving crowds. You’ll walk through the very gate Jaime Lannister slipped back into after his capture — while no one recognized him.

5
Stop 5

Wandering the narrow streets of Old Town, we’ll find filming spots tied to Sansa’s escape after the Purple Wedding, Tyrion’s conversations with Oberyn Martell, and Littlefinger’s brothel. Each corner hides a story — both from Westeros and from Dubrovnik’s own dramatic history.

6

No Game of Thrones tour is complete without the Jesuit Stairs — the site of Cersei’s infamous Walk of Shame. Here’s your chance to ring the bell, shout “Shame!” and recreate one of the show’s most iconic scenes. Cameras ready — this is the ultimate photo moment.

7

We finish in true Westerosi style at the Game of Thrones shop, where you can sit on a life-sized Iron Throne replica. Strike your best kingly (or queenly) pose and take home the ultimate souvenir photo.

Must-Try Local Dishes

Black Risotto (Crni Rižot)

A traditional Dalmatian dish made with cuttlefish or squid ink, giving it a distinctive black color. It's often served with a side of white wine.

Main Course Contains seafood, not suitable for vegetarians or those with seafood allergies.

Peka

A slow-cooked dish made with meat (lamb, veal, or octopus) and vegetables, cooked under a bell-like lid with hot coals on top.

Main Course Can be made with meat or seafood, not suitable for vegetarians.

Rožata

A traditional Dalmatian dessert similar to crème caramel, made with eggs, sugar, and cream, and flavored with lemon or orange zest.

Dessert Contains dairy and eggs, not suitable for vegans.
